The Chesham Arms in Homerton held its annual pumpkin carving competition on 30 October and chose Hackney Giving as the cause to benefit from funds raised.
Pub guests carved some fantastic lanterns to light the way into winter. There were several faces to scare away the baddies as well as a Bugs Bunny, the iconic AC/DC logo and the winner: the ghostbusters symbol.
The pub garden looked 100% monster-proof with the candle-lit lanterns glowing under the awning. And there were definitely no ghosts allowed!
A massive thank you to our friends at The Chesham Arms and to everyone who took part and donated. The money raised will go towards community projects in Hackney and the City of London that support health and wellbeing or which bring people together to reduce isolation.
